In the following passage some words have been deleted. Fill in the blanks with the help of the alternatives given. Select the most appropriate option for each blank. Namita did not have enough cash. She did not (1)______ a credit card either. She found herself in a (2)______ . She had the contact number of a (3)______ friend whom she called for help. Her friend came (4)______ and settled the bill. Namita thanked her and expressed her (5)______. She promised to return the money to her friend soon.
Select the most appropriate option to fill in blank no. 4.
purposely
regularly
immediately
slowly
- Namita did not have enough cash, and she also didn't have a credit card, which put her in a difficult situation.
- She was in a predicament and needed help quickly to settle her bill.
- She called a friend for assistance.
- The friend came to her aid to help resolve the situation.
Option Explanation:
- 1, purposely - This implies intentional action, which doesn’t fit the context of helping someone quickly.
- 2, regularly - This implies a habitual action, not suitable for a one-time, urgent need.
- 3, immediately - This suggests quick and prompt action, which fits the need for urgent assistance.
- 4, slowly - This suggests a delayed action, which is contrary to the prompt help needed.
